Hand tools are manually operated tools that do not require electricity or external power. They are widely used in various trades for tasks like cutting, shaping, assembling, and repairing. Common examples include hammers, screwdrivers, pliers, and spanners.
PEX Tube Expander
A PEX Tube Expander is a hand tool used to expand the end of PEX tubing so that fittings can be inserted easily. It works by widening the pipe using an expanding head, allowing the pipe to temporarily stretch and then contract tightly around the fitting to form a secure and leak-proof connection. This method is commonly used in PEX plumbing systems.
PEX Crimp Tool
A PEX Crimp Tool is a hand tool used to create secure connections in PEX (cross-linked polyethylene) piping systems. It works by compressing a metal crimp ring around the pipe and fitting, ensuring a tight and leak-proof joint. This tool is widely used in modern plumbing systems for water supply lines.

Plumbing Snake Auger
A Plumbing Snake Auger is a hand tool used to clear blockages in pipes and drains. It consists of a flexible coiled metal cable with a cutting or auger head at one end, which is inserted into the pipe to break up or pull out obstructions. It is widely used in plumbing work for cleaning clogged drains and maintaining smooth flow in pipelines.

Pipe Threading Kit
A Pipe Threading Kit is a set of hand tools used to cut external threads on pipes so that they can be joined with fittings such as couplings, elbows, and valves. The kit typically includes dies, die stock (handle), and accessories required for threading. It is widely used in plumbing and pipe installation work.
Flint Spark Lighter
A Flint Spark Lighter is a hand tool used to safely ignite gas in welding and cutting operations. It produces a spark by striking a flint against a rough surface, which ignites the gas coming from a welding torch. This tool eliminates the need for matches or lighters, making it safer for industrial use.
